Output df64d001be809a3299bd080130cccb2c876027cd4a9fcefd27119f006cb66271:0

value
355508
script pubkey
OP_0 OP_PUSHBYTES_20 cfba188beb8e03d1ef07bfb7e54bdcfb942374e6
address
bc1qe7ap3zlt3cparmc8h7m72j7ulw2zxa8x9qrrlc
transaction
df64d001be809a3299bd080130cccb2c876027cd4a9fcefd27119f006cb66271
confirmations
306755
spent
true